The Tangible Difference: Feel and Fiber
Fast fashion thrives on that immediate, often deceptive, softness. It’s often achieved through chemical treatments or looser weaves that look good on the hanger but lack structural integrity. The initial touch might be pleasant, almost slick, but this sensation is fleeting. It’s built for impulse, not endurance.
That initial softness is often a whisper, not a promise. It disappears, leaving you with something shapeless.
With organic GOTS cotton, the experience is often different. The initial feel can be substantial, perhaps a little firmer than what you expect from a chemically softened garment. But this isn’t a flaw; it’s an indication of its integrity. The fibers haven’t been stripped or weakened. Instead, they are robust, ready to soften beautifully over time, wash after wash, becoming truly yours. This is the truth behind garments like our Thread & Thunder Organic Sweatshirt.
Beyond the Surface: Cost and Supply Chain Realities
The price difference between a conventional garment and a GOTS certified organic cotton piece isn’t just arbitrary. It reflects an entire supply chain built on different principles. From organic farming practices that avoid harmful pesticides to ethical labor standards and rigorous processing controls, every step costs more. It’s an investment in a traceable, verifiable process, not just a label. The GOTS Certified Material Truth
The featured Thread & Thunder Organic Sweatshirt is crafted from a 280 GSM fabric blend: 80% Organic Cotton and 20% Recycled Polyester. This blend is certified by G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ard) for the organic cotton content, OCS (Organic Content Standard) for the blend, and GRS (Global Recycled Standard) for the recycled polyester. The entire garment is also PETA-Approved Vegan. These certifications ensure traceability and verifiable standards from fiber to finished product.
